With El Rey, Stephen Starr continues to expand his Philadelphia restaurant empire -- he's already got Buddakan, El Vez, and Morimoto, among many others. Safe to say, this is another success. It's a Mexican restaurant with an interior that's modeled after the cantina in <em>From Dusk Till Dawn</em>, so it's got vintage movie posters, old instruments, and some prison art. Oh, and the food's not bad either, with a menu that offers meatballs in a spicy salsa, queso fundido, roasted red snapper, and more.

Restaurateur Stephen Starr’s El Rey is all about modern meets homemade. Happy hour runs Monday through Friday and features discounted tacos and $5 classic margaritas, but stop by anytime for Blue Shrimp Ceviche, Brisket Quesadillas, and Veracruz-style Paella made with chicken, chorizo, shrimp, squid, and more. El Rey also offers a nice setting for a lazy brunch on Saturdays and Sundays, from noon to 4 pm.
